I. Attention Catcher:

II. Listener Relevance: Connect your audience to the essence (the thesis) of your speech. How will they be able to relate to its message?

III. Speaker Credibility: Why are you believeable?

IV. Thesis Statement: (What is the overriding point of your introduction?) By the end of the speech you will. . .     

V.  Preview: (The preview literally tells in which order your body of ideas will be discussed). For example, "First, I will discuss my early years growing up in Newark, then I will discuss how moving to Clifton changed my life and lastly, I will discuss the events that led to decision to return to school at the age of 35").

Step 1: Choose something about which you feel really strongly:

Internet and Social networking sites have been one of the major platforms of consumer shopping as it is easiest, convenience and time saving.

Step 2: Counter-arguments people generally have to my point of view:

  • The internet is not a safe and secure medium for shopping
  • Youths spent a high time on social networking sites to make friends not for shopping
  • The majority of people still prefer a traditional way of shopping not internet or online shopping
  • Cyber crime and internet issue restricted the consumers to purchase product through online.
